This apprenticeship will provide an opportunity for learning, development and work experience and offers a supported approach to new career opportunities and further education in the drug and alcohol sector. As part of this role, you will gain experience of the Lancashire Young Person's treatment system, assist in assessing user needs and providing positive interventions that encourage, motivate and assist service users to address their substance misuse. This is a great opportunity to learn more about providing support, information, training, education and guidance to young people, as well as working to improve access to appropriate services.



You will be working in partnership with the local authority and will work between We Are With You offices and the local authority offices, therefore a full UK driving licence and access to a vehicle is required for this role.



This is full time position working 37.5 hours per week Monday to Friday between 09:00 and 17:00.

This position is fixed term until 31/03/2026.

We offer a salary of 20,000 - 23,809.50 per annum.

About Us



WithYou provides free and confidential support, without judgement, to more than 100,000 people every year experiencing challenges with drugs, alcohol and mental health across England and Scotland.



Our name reflects who we are - a positive place where people can progress, connect with others and get friendly, expert help in a way that's right for them.
